Compact stores, smaller orders: How Yum China aims to grow in lower-tier cities

Yum China’s first-quarter results for this year are as strong as ever. Operating profit was US$374 million, and core operating profit grew 1 per cent to $396 million. Total revenues increased 1 per cent year-on-year to $2.96 billion. Delivery sales grew by 12 per cent year-on-year and accounted for approximately 38 per cent of KFC and Pizza Hut’s company sales.
